First off, let's understand what a High Speed Slitter Rewinder Machine does. In simple terms, it's a piece of equipment used to cut large rolls of material, like plastic film, paper, or metal foil, into narrower rolls. The machine unwinds the large roll, slits it into multiple smaller widths, and then rewinds these smaller rolls onto cores. This process is widely used in industries such as packaging, printing, and converting.

Now, when it comes to drive systems, there are several types commonly used in High Speed Slitter Rewinder Machines. The most popular ones include mechanical drives, hydraulic drives, and electric drives. Each type has its own set of advantages and disadvantages, and the compatibility with the slitter rewinder depends on various factors.

Let's start with mechanical drives. These drives use belts, gears, and pulleys to transfer power from the motor to the machine's components. They are relatively simple in design and have been used in industrial machinery for a long time. One of the main advantages of mechanical drives is their reliability. They are robust and can handle high loads without much trouble. However, they do have some limitations. For example, they can be noisy, and the speed control might not be as precise as other drive systems. In terms of compatibility with High Speed Slitter Rewinder Machines, mechanical drives can work well for applications where the speed requirements are not extremely high and where a simple, reliable drive system is sufficient. But for high-speed operations that require precise speed control and quick acceleration and deceleration, mechanical drives might not be the best choice.

Next up are hydraulic drives. Hydraulic drives use pressurized fluid to transmit power. They offer high torque and can provide smooth and precise control of the machine's movements. Hydraulic drives are particularly useful in applications where a lot of force is required, such as in heavy-duty slitting and rewinding operations. They can also handle sudden changes in load without much impact on the machine's performance. However, hydraulic drives can be quite complex and expensive to install and maintain. They also require regular fluid changes and can be prone to leaks. When it comes to compatibility with High Speed Slitter Rewinder Machines, hydraulic drives can be a good option for applications that require high force and precise control, but they might not be the most cost-effective choice for all types of operations.

Finally, we have electric drives. Electric drives are becoming increasingly popular in High Speed Slitter Rewinder Machines due to their many advantages. They offer precise speed control, high efficiency, and low maintenance requirements. Electric drives can be easily integrated with modern control systems, allowing for advanced features such as programmable speed profiles and remote monitoring. There are different types of electric drives, including DC drives, AC drives, and servo drives. DC drives were once the most common type, but they are being gradually replaced by AC drives and servo drives. AC drives are more energy-efficient and have better speed control capabilities. Servo drives, on the other hand, offer the highest level of precision and can provide extremely accurate positioning and speed control. They are ideal for high-speed, high-precision slitting and rewinding applications. In terms of compatibility, electric drives are generally a great choice for High Speed Slitter Rewinder Machines, especially for applications that require high precision and energy efficiency.

So, how do you choose the right drive system for your High Speed Slitter Rewinder Machine? Well, it depends on several factors. First, you need to consider the speed requirements of your application. If you need to operate the machine at very high speeds, an electric drive, especially a servo drive, might be the best option. Second, you need to think about the precision required. If your application demands extremely accurate slitting and rewinding, a drive system that offers precise control, such as an electric servo drive, is essential. Third, you need to consider the cost. While electric drives might offer the best performance, they can also be more expensive than mechanical or hydraulic drives. You need to balance the performance requirements with your budget.

In addition to the type of drive system, there are other factors that can affect the compatibility between the High Speed Slitter Rewinder Machine and the drive system. For example, the control system of the machine plays a crucial role. The control system needs to be able to communicate effectively with the drive system to ensure proper operation. It should be able to adjust the speed, torque, and other parameters of the drive system based on the requirements of the slitting and rewinding process. Another factor is the mechanical design of the machine. The machine's components, such as the rollers, blades, and tensioning devices, need to be designed in such a way that they can work in harmony with the drive system.
